Output 7de1335706a31a76579e21c856c6a12ea814087113e27b2d22b7c987ee94a83e:0

value
11147538
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 65756ca9370fcd56938beaa3deebc2cf68c1197a OP_EQUALVERIFY OP_CHECKSIG
address
1AFTvAp7tvneq6CTAKUMMxLJQEgUDXZSxJ
transaction
7de1335706a31a76579e21c856c6a12ea814087113e27b2d22b7c987ee94a83e
spent
true